A method for landmark-based localization of a vehicle involves forming a plurality of position hypotheses for a vehicle position based on a forming of associations between sensor landmark objects detected by sensor and map landmark objects stored in a digital map. A most likely vehicle position is ascertained as the localization result on the basis of a probabilistic filtering of the position hypotheses, and a guaranteed position area is ascertained, in which a predefined error upper limit is not exceeded. This is performed several times with different set-ups of the probabilistic filtering. The localization result with the smallest guaranteed position area is selected as vehicle position if the guaranteed position areas overlap fully in pairs.

A method for landmark-based localization of a vehicle, the method comprising: receiving, by an autonomous driving system of the vehicle, a determined current vehicle position; and controlling the vehicle by the autonomous driving system so long as the determined current vehicle position has an integrity that is below an alert limit threshold value for the autonomous driving system of the vehicle, wherein the current vehicle position is determined by a) forming, by the vehicle, a plurality of position hypotheses for a vehicle position based on associations formed between sensor landmark objects detected by a sensor of the vehicle and map landmark objects stored in a digital map; b) probabilistically filtering, by the vehicle, the plurality of position hypotheses to produce a probability distribution of the vehicle position in the digital map; c) determining, by the vehicle, a most likely vehicle position as a localization result based on probability distribution of the vehicle position in the digital map, and determining a guaranteed position area, in which a predefined error upper limit is not exceeded, wherein steps a)-c) are performed several times with different configurations of the probabilistic filtering so that there are several localization results, wherein the different configurations of the probabilistic filtering relate to stringency of the configuration for discarding improbable position hypotheses, and wherein one localization result of the several localization results from performing the steps a)-c) several times is selected as the determined current vehicle position if the guaranteed position areas from performing the steps a)-c) several times overlap fully in pairs, wherein the one localization result has a smallest guaranteed position area of the determined guaranteed position areas. 2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the different configurations of the probabilistic filtering relate to a feature association filter, in which the plurality of position hypotheses are filtered and the improbable position hypotheses are discarded. 3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: outputting an error message if at least one pair of the guaranteed position areas from performing the steps a)-c) several times overlap only in part. 4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the selected vehicle position (eFP) is assigned to all larger guaranteed position areas from performing the steps a)-c) several times. 5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the steps a)-c) are performed at least three times. 6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the performing of the steps a)-c) several times with different configurations of the probabilistic filtering is performed in a plurality of parallel branches of the method. 7. The method of claim 6 , wherein each of the plurality of parallel branches comprise a feature association filter, wherein the feature association filters of the plurality of parallel branches are configured differently, and wherein reliable position hypotheses is determined based on the feature association filters of the plurality of parallel branches. 8. The method of claim 7 , wherein, in each of the plurality of parallel branches, the reliable position hypothesis of the branch and an inherent movement of the vehicle are processed by a Kalman filter, and thus a corresponding localization result of each of the plurality of branches and a corresponding guaranteed position area of each of the plurality of branches, in which the predefined error upper limit is not exceeded, are determined. 9. The method of claim 1 , wherein sensor landmark objects already passed by the vehicle are used for the forming of the associations between the sensor landmark objects detected by sensor and the map landmark objects stored in the digital map. 10. The method of claim 1 , wherein the sensor landmark objects detected by the sensor over a predefined time period or over a predefined route length are used for the forming of the associations between the sensor landmark objects detected by sensor and the map landmark objects stored in the digital map.
